hi,
what is the difference between ldom and zone. can we install any other os than sun in ldom.
thanks,
snj.
Ldom is a full blown domain, where you can install the version of Solaris that you want as long as it supports beeing a ldoms guest.
Ldoms is more similar to Vmware esx server where you have a server that you create virtual hosts on and then install the OS in them.
A zone is created inside the OS, and runs closly connected to the OS, they use the same kernel etc.

LDOMs can be configured on specific hardware.( Sun T series ) But zones can be configured on any hardware platform including x86.
